The Future Impact: Benefits and Challenges of Digital Currency in Vanuatu's Citizenship Program
The introduction of digital currency options in Vanuatu's Citizenship Program presents a dual-edged sword, offering both significant benefits and notable challenges. On one hand, the integration of digital currencies can streamline the investment process, making it more accessible for global investors. This innovation could enhance the program's appeal, attracting a diverse range of applicants who are keen on utilizing modern financial technologies. Furthermore, the use of digital currencies may foster greater transparency in transactions, potentially reducing the risks associated with corruption and fraud.
However, these advancements are not without their hurdles. The volatility of digital currencies poses a risk to both investors and the integrity of the program. Fluctuations in value could lead to complications in meeting investment thresholds, potentially discouraging participation. Additionally, the regulatory landscape surrounding digital currencies remains uncertain, which could create compliance challenges for both the government and prospective citizens. Balancing these benefits and challenges will be crucial as Vanuatu navigates this new frontier in its citizenship offerings.
